Transaction f31a0364d8ebfa94014644c782e36589af9decab85f60dd3bec48438053d87a6
1 Input
1 Output
-
f31a0364d8ebfa94014644c782e36589af9decab85f60dd3bec48438053d87a6:0
- value
- 1550409
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 371153490bb286c9661a0082aeca0347b9bd3e3724691d509fdd2977bc165a26
- address
- bc1pxug4xjgtk2rvjes6qzp2ajsrg7um603hy35365ylm55h00qktgnq7qcjhy